We are glad to welcome Andrew Robertson, President & Chief Executive Officer of BBDO Worldwide, as speaker at the DLD 06.


Mr. Robertson, 43, was the youngest CEO ever at BBDO when he took the reins on June 1, 2004. He has been with BBDO Worldwide since 1995, serving as CEO of Abbott Mead Vickers BBDO, in London. In 2001, he joined BBDO North America as President, CEO and was elected to the Worldwide Board of Directors. In 2002, he was named to the additional post of President, BBDO Worldwide. He has also previously worked at Ogilvy & Mather Worldwide and J. Walter Thompson Co., both now part of WPP Group.
